React Native 相关学习
layout: post title: “React Native Learning” description: "" category: devtech/react tags: [react native] top: true
React 相关
- React 官网
- Ant Design 蚂蚁金服ui库
- Ant Design Pro 上手备忘录
- Bi Sheng 转化 markdown 文档为静态单页面 React 应用
- 從零開始學 ReactJS
- React 中文文档
- React 最佳实践——那些 React 没告诉你但很重要的事
- 基于 Jest + Enzyme 的 React 单元测试
- How to debug Jest tests with VSCode
- react-motion React 动画效果库
- redux-saga 实践总结
- 集成方案:
- React + Redux + RESTfulAPI
- React + Relay + GraphQL
- Relay: 全新的React数据获取框架
- antizer ClojureScript library for Ant Design React UI components
- React Loadable A higher order component for loading components with promises. 用 promise 加载组件的高阶组件,可用于 React 显示加载、代码分离、服务端渲染等。
- roadhog Cli tool for creating react apps, configurable version of create-react-app. 创建可配置的 React 应用的命令行工具,集成了 Jest, Enzyme 等。
在组件间共享函数的方法:
参考此文:通过示例理解 React 的 render props 技巧
- render props, 更适合只读的函数,例如跟踪滚动条、鼠标动作等;
- HOC(High order component), 更适合较复杂的方法,如 local storage 等;
相关文档资料
- react-devtools
- React Developer Tools
- 比 React Native 更好的选择:Flutter 使用 Dart 语言编写 App。
- React Native是原生开发的末日吗?
- React Native: Is it the end of native development?
Style 的笔记
- alignItems ReactPropTypes.oneOf([ ‘flex-start’, ‘flex-end’, ‘center’, ‘stretch’ ])
- stretch 向两边伸展
- alignSelf ReactPropTypes.oneOf([ ‘auto’, ‘flex-start’, ‘flex-end’, ‘center’, ‘stretch’ ])
- flexDirection ReactPropTypes.oneOf([ ‘row’, ‘row-reverse’, ‘column’, ‘column-reverse’ ])
- flexWrap ReactPropTypes.oneOf([ ‘wrap’, ’nowrap’ ])
- justifyContent ReactPropTypes.oneOf([ ‘flex-start’, ‘flex-end’, ‘center’, ‘space-between’, ‘space-around’ ])